Shell to pull out of energy investments in Russia over war

Summary by Ground News
BP announced on Sunday that it would exit its 19.75% holding in state-owned Rosneft, with CEO Bernard Looney and former chief Bob Dudley both resigning from its board. Equinor announced today that it will begin exiting joint ventures in the country. Shell has a 27.5% stake in Gazprom's Sakhalin-2 offshore gas project.
